What are the Benefits of Using a Whole House Water Filter?
Whole home water filters are the best choice for people that have an interest in having a home that offers clean, drinkable water. Along with offering quality drinking water throughout the house, a whole residence water filter additionally gives advantages such as eliminating pollutants that create spotting in water that is made use of to clean recipes. Unfiltered water can additionally create problem such as corroding plumbing and appliances, destroying clothing that is washed and stain sinks or showers. Although whole residence water filters are normally used in residential residences, they can additionally be a reliable choice for houses or offices.

At first, it might appear that whole home water filters would be extremely expensive when contrasted to various other filter alternatives, however they are really an extremely affordable option for water filtration. The rate variety of these water filters is large, beginning at 2 hundred bucks as well as costing as high as one thousand bucks. The cost of the filters is dependent upon their size, product and also life expectancy. This may seem like an extremely high cost, but when compared to various other filter choices, it is actually really economical due to the amount of filtering system that it provides.

Entire home water filters purify water in the very same style that other filters, such as countertop or under sink filters, do. The distinction is that it needs only one filter, which is affixed to the primary water source, rather than needing multiple water filters to be attached to different tools. Similar to the various other filters, entire home water filters cleanse tap water by forcing it via numerous various phases of filtering. One of the stages is carbon filtration. Carbon is a reliable approach of filtering system water since it is porous and has the ability to get rid of tiny as well as big impurities. Carbon is essential in getting rid of unpredictable organic carbon compounds, which in many cases can trigger major damage to the liver, kidney or main nerves. Carbon likewise removes dangerous substances such as chemicals, industrial solvents and also insecticides.

Another necessary step of the purification process entails a procedure such as ionization or micron filtration. This action removes thousands of pollutants located in tap water, and transforms the water to great sampling, healthy alcohol consumption water. As mentioned previously, the main benefit of whole residence water filters are that they offer filtered water throughout your house with the use of only one filter.

An additional advantage of whole home water filters is the lengthy life span that they use. Many of these filters last between fifty as well as one hundred thousand gallons of water. For many, the main downside of entire house filters is the more than ordinary rate. Although these filters are very budget-friendly, they do need a huge investment up front. Entire residence water filters can likewise call for a considerable quantity work to set up.

THE IMPORTANCE OF WATER FILTRATION


Water is such an essential part of our daily lives that many times we don’t stop to consider where it’s being sourced or the quality of it. We assume we’re receiving the best possible output. For many, tap water is deemed undrinkable, which is where filtered water comes into play. The importance of water filtration is that it gives people access to clean water that is free of contaminants, that tastes good, and is a reliable source of hydration. Without it, there’s the risk of becoming ill from contaminated water or the alternative of drinking other beverages that may not be as good for your health as purified water.



There are different types of filtered water but all offer the basics of the water purification process. This involves water that has been strained of harmful chemicals, pesticides, bacteria, and other particles that contaminate the water. Although public water systems have filtration protocols in place, these vary from state to state. It depends on where your water supply is sourced from originally, the way it is treated, and the quality of water pipes. For example, older water filtration systems that use lead pipes may be harmful to the final dispersal of water because of lead leaching from the pipes into the water.


FILTERED WATER SOLUTIONS THAT REMOVE CONTAMINATION AND IMPURITIES


Fortunately, there are several ways people can get filtered water. A water filter has microscopic holes that remove sediment and pollutants from the water. The smaller the holes, the less it allows to pass through and the cleaner the water is. The way each type of water filtration system works is slightly different. The most common options are bottled water, at-home filters, reverse osmosis units, and alkaline water.


BOTTLED WATER


Billions of gallons of bottled water are sold yearly as demand for it continues to increase. Although perceived as an inexpensive, convenient filtered water option, it is more costly in the long run than other filtered water choices. The price of bottled water is nearly 2,000 times the cost of tap water and has vastly increased the amount of plastic waste affecting our environment.


FILTER FAUCET ATTACHMENTS AND PITCHERS


These types of filters are easily obtained and are effective in improving the taste of tap water. They help to reduce lead and solids by using a filter screen to capture small particles. In some cases, these types of filtration solutions use a block of activated carbon that helps to remove unpleasant odors and tastes that might be present in your water.



When using either of these at-home options, it’s important to change the filter on a regularly scheduled basis. Failure to do so causes build up in the filters and the water that passes through may not be as clean as desired. Also, when it comes to the availability of filtered water using pitchers, they constantly need to be refilled and there is a period of waiting time until purified drinking water is available again. This is an inconvenience when using in larger households or in organizations where a large group of people is relying on a consistent source of filtered water.
